Cruise Port Guru is a free reference for cruise ports around the world. One page per port, the same practical brief every time, written for the seven or eight hours you actually have.

Built to be a genuine guide.

Most port information online is trying to sell you something. Search any port name and you get excursion listings dressed as advice, forum threads from 2014, and cruise line pages that would rather you stayed on a coach all day.

What's missing is dull and useful: where the ship actually ties up, how long the walk into town really is, whether the cable car queue is worth it at 9am, and what time you need to turn around. That's the whole site.

Every port follows the same structure, so once you've read one guide you know where to look in all of them. No page is sponsored, no ranking is paid for, and when doing it yourself beats a booked tour, we say so plainly.
